Step 1 of this answer says Install Cake.CoreCLR NuGet package to your tools folder
. How do I do that?
Things I've tried:
> dotnet add package Cake.CoreCLR --version 0.38.4
Could not find any project in `current folder`.
Usage: dotnet add <PROJECT> package [options] <PACKAGE_NAME>
and
> dotnet tool install Cake.CoreCLR --version 0.38.4 -g
error NU1212: Invalid project-package combination for Cake.CoreCLR 0.38.4. DotnetToolReference project style can only contain references of the DotnetTool type
The tool package could not be restored.
Tool 'cake.coreclr' failed to install. This failure may have been caused by:
* You are attempting to install a preview release and did not use the --version option to specify the version.
* A package by this name was found, but it was not a .NET Core tool.
* The required NuGet feed cannot be accessed, perhaps because of an Internet connection problem.
* You mistyped the name of the tool.
For more reasons, including package naming enforcement, visit https://aka.ms/failure-installing-tool
